Water works in Merchants Quay, Constitution Hill and Donor’s Green

Irish Water will be carrying out essential valve repair works this week in Merchants Quay, Drogheda and consumers in Constitution Hill to Donor’s Green and surrounding areas may experience low water pressure and/or water outages from today, Monday 22 February, to Thursday 25 February between 9:00am and 6:00pm daily. 

It may take 2-3 hours for normal water supply to return to all customers but it is important to continue to follow the HSE guidance on hand-washing. 

Irish Water and Louth County Council understands the inconvenience caused and thanks customers for their patience while they complete these essential works and restore normal supply to impacted customers.
